What is a Sash Window?
A sash window usually includes one or more movable panels (sashes) that can be vertically or horizontally opened. These windows are defined by their distinct design, which frequently includes glazing bars, beading, and frame designs that reflect the architectural styles of their era. Sash windows offer a number of unique advantages:
Aesthetic Appeal: They boost the architectural integrity of buildings.Ventilation Control: They permit for versatile ventilation options.Natural Light: Their generous sizing promotes an abundance of natural light inside.

Repairing sash windows needs organized steps to ensure quality results. Below is a comprehensive breakdown of the typical actions carried out by sash window repair business:
1. Initial Inspection
An extensive assessment is carried out to recognize concerns such as rot, broken glass, or defective mechanisms.
2. Elimination of Sashes
The next step involves carefully getting rid of the sashes from the frame for repair without causing additional damage.
3. Wood Treatment
If rot is spotted, impacted areas are dealt with, and harmed wood is replaced using similar products to maintain consistency.
4. Glazing Replacement
Broken or leaking glass panes are changed, guaranteeing correct sealing to avoid drafts and moisture ingress.
5. Repainting and Finishing
Once repairs are finished, sashes are repainted and completed to restore their original appearance.
6. Reinstallation
The fixed sashes are reinstalled, making sure functionality and smooth movement.
7. Final Inspection
A quality check is performed to make sure that the windows run smoothly and effectively.
